1. Cut Photos on Google Docs
To crop photos on Google Docs, use the Tools menu. First select the image you want to cut, then click Menu Tools and select the Crop Image option. Alternatively, just right-click on the image, select the Crop option from the Menu.
The fastest way is to double click on the image, at which time the cropping frame will appear, you can adjust the area to crop the image.

2. Rotate Photos on Google Docs

Simply insert your image into Google Doc and click on the image to select it. You should now see the rotate button in the top corner of the image. Click on the button and drag to rotate the image. In addition, you will also see the degree of rotation to rotate the image more accurately.
